In disposing of their wastes, all three HUCs rely on a private-owned landfill in Barangay Binaliw, Cebu City called the ARN Central Waste Management. Social Services After learning that 40% of Makatis solid waste were recyclable materials which could be reduced, reused and recycled, the city government came up with their Solid Waste Diversion and Reduction Program which initially aimed to reduce solid waste by 25 percent within five years starting in 2003. In addition to not having a formal MRF of its own, the city has also yet to get approval for its 10-year solid waste management plan, according to reports from the Department of Environment and Natural Resources Environmental Bureau and the Commission on Audit. The current dynamic, fast-talking LGU head gives credit where its due, however, and recounts how the workreally began under the term of her predecessor, former Barangay Captain Jojit Desingao, who has since beenelected a Tagaytay City Councilor. The eco-book is an easy way for people to keep track of credits earned fromgarbage collection. The barangay localgovernment unit (LGU) doesnt believe in justmaking do; in fact, even the pamphlets on SWMwhich they give away are nicely printed on thick,water-resistant paper, not cheap photocopies thatare useless when wet.
